The important driver increasing growth in the global marine biotechnology market is the developing healthcare sector. Various marine bioactive compounds are being developed into new drugs to treat cancer and pain.
The product segment of the marine biotechnology market is growing rapidly due to the booming healthcare industry. Biomaterials are used to replace soft or hard tissues which are destroyed or damaged. There is remarkable research going on biomaterial and its use in a broad range of applications like orthopedics, ophthalmic, wound healing, dental and cardiovascular application. Marine bioactive compounds are organic compounds produced by microbes, gorgonians, sponges, soft and hard corals seaweeds, and other marine organisms. These substances are the interest of research industries for new chemicals and drugs. Many marine organisms provide useful drugs. For instance, liver oil from fish enables rich sources of vitamins D, and A. Insulin can be extracted from tuna fish, whales, and a red alga. Algae and seaweeds are a source of omega-3 fatty acids.Omega-3 fatty acids EPA and DHA are known to minimize the risk of early death.
 Lack of research in oceans is restraining the growth of the marine biotechnology market. Life in the ocean, where development starts contains more key taxonomic groups (phyla); which have separate evolutionary path than those observed on the land. There is a limited knowledge regarding ocean bioresources, especially those in the deep ocean. Such complexities in terms of the innovation of marine bioresources significantly challenge the market growth. Thus, there is a need for new infrastructure and novelty of models in this market.

The marine biotechnology market in North America is expected to hold the largest share by 2026, owing to the increasing growth of biomaterial-based medical applications such as knee implants, bone morph genic proteins, artificial ligaments, bone plates, and dental implants. Extensive research for marine biofuels has propelled the market of marine biotechnology in the North American countries. On the other hand, the Asia-Pacific market is anticipated to the fastest-growing region for the marine biotechnology market. Huge exports of marine food products dominate the Asia Pacific Marine biotechnology market. China is the world’s largest exporter of seafood; with 12% of share in total seafood exports globally. Other factors driving the marine biotechnology market are a huge amount of research prevailing for marine biodiscovery and new molecule identification.

The marine biotechnology market is also segmented based on the basis of technology which is sub-divided into culture-independent techniques, enrichment, isolation and cultivation of microorganisms and large-scale implementation. Culture-independent techniques such as functional based screening, small microsomal RNA (rRNA), gel microdroplets and others are extensively utilized in the identification of strains of microorganisms within an hour, without the need to culture or grow the organism in the laboratory. Enrichment, isolation and cultivation technology or simply culture based technology involves isolation of microbes by separating them from other species and preparation of pure culture with the help of enrichment media (both synthetic and non-synthetic) to favour their growth. Large-scale implementation involves culturing the marine microorganisms for the mass production of bioactive, biomaterials for commercial utilization with the help of bioreactors.

Aker Bio-marine is a Norwegian company, established as an independent entity in 2006. Headquarter of the company is located in Oslo, Norway. The company deals with krill-based nutrition supplements, pet food, and aquaculture products. The company has its presence in the US, Europe, India, China, and Australia. Another company, BASF SE, is the largest chemical producer in the world. The company was founded in 1865 and is headquartered in Ludwigshafen, Germany. The company employs more than 112,000 employees worldwide. The company has a wide range of products, and it mainly deals in sectors like chemical, plastics, crop technology, and crude oil & natural gas.
